Key Hubs Supporting the freight forwarder in Mongolia

Mongolia’s freight forwarding infrastructure is centered around critical logistics hubs that simplify global trade. The capital city, Ulaanbaatar, helps as the main hub for air forwarding and cargo freight forwarders. Chinggis Khaan International Airport supports air forwarding for valuable goods, while the Trans-Mongolian Railway is a vital connecting Mongolia with Russia and China, enabling effective freight forwarding services by rail. Across the region, such as Zamyn-Uud on the China-Mongolia region and Altanbulag on the Russia-Mongolia edge, play a necessary role in managing cargo forwarding services under various incoterms. These crossings help as an entrance for imports and exports, with customs brokers confirming that shipments conform to regulations and tariff structures. As Mongolia continues to increase its logistics infrastructure, these crucial hubs will be critical to simplifying cargo forwarding services.

DID YOU KNOW?

In 2023, Mongolia exported about 15.19 billion US dollars worth of goods. In 2023, Mongolia imported about 9.25 billion US dollars worth of goods.
